Oh, Dearest Mother, Sweetest Virgin of Altagracia, our Patroness. You are our Advocate and to you we recommend our needs. You are our Teacher and like disciples we come to learn from the example of your holy life. You are our Mother, and like children, we come to offer you all of the love of our hearts. Receive, dearest Mother, our offerings and listen attentively to our supplications. Amen.

The Sunday readings follow a 3 year cycle (A,B,C) and the weekday readings are on a 2 year cycle (I, II). But there is a little chart in the missal that tells you what cycle (Sunday and weekday) you're in. It's very easy to use. And it comes with about 8 ribbon bookmarks that make it very easy to flip around.

Martha, I was thinking about you and wondered if you were aware that there is a magazine subscription called Magnificat that is a monthly missal. It includes all the readings and prayers for daily Mass, morning and evening prayers, and a daily meditation. They also publish one for children for the Sunday readings. It's very nicely done. I've used it in the past and really enjoyed it.
